After a string of three wins, the Collegiate Cougars's good fortune finally ran out on Tuesday. The contest between them and St. Anne's-Belfield wasn't particularly close, with Collegiate falling 68-54. While losing is never fun, Collegiate can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Virginia basketball rankings (they are ranked 91st, while St. Anne's-Belfield is ranked first).
Chance Mallory was his usual excellent self, dropping a double-double on 40 points and 22 rebounds for St. Anne's-Belfield. Another player making a difference was Danzelle Bullock coles, who scored 12 points along with six rebounds.
Collegiate's defeat 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 13-12. As for St. Anne's-Belfield, their win was their seventh stra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 21-3.
Collegiate will take on St. Christopher's at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. St. Christopher's has been dominant on offense recently, as they've racked up an incredible 523 points over their last eight contests. As for St. Anne's-Belfield, they will be playing at home against Trinity Episcopal at 6:00 p.m. on Friday.
